How you’ll contribute

Our Cath Lab Technician provides direct and indirect patient care in accordance with applicable scope and standards of practice.

Perform technical and supportive patient care before, during, and after cardiac catheterization and interventional procedures.

Assist cardiologists with invasive procedures, including cardiac catheterizations, coronary interventions, peripheral vascular procedures, pacemaker/ICD insertions, Swan-Ganz catheter placement, and intra-aortic balloon pump support.

Monitor and interpret hemodynamics, ECGs, and waveform data while continually assessing and responding to changes in patient condition.

Prepare, operate, and maintain cath lab equipment; ensure safety standards, quality control, and infection control practices are followed.

Review patient history, verify orders and identification, provide patient education, and document assessments and procedural details accurately.

Participate in performance improvement and quality assurance activities, maintain readiness for call rotation, and support workflow efficiency within the cardiovascular services team.
